Lansing, Michigan Metro Area Top 5 Home Sales: Crane Meadow Home With Heated Pool Sells for $800,000

A 2002 home on a 1.389-acre lot in Grand Ledge’s Crane Meadow neighborhood sold for $800,000, the highest-priced of five home sales reported in the Lansing, Michigan metro area for the week ending August 16, 2026. Together, the five closings totaled $2.97 million.

The week’s sales reached Grand Ledge, East Lansing, Okemos, Saint Johns and DeWitt, in neighborhoods including Crane Meadow, Greens at Walnut Hills, Hidden Valley and Lakeside Preserve. The homes were built between 1986 and 2004, and every one has a finished lower level. Acreage, in-ground pools, deeded recreational land and private lake access all appear on the list.

No. 1 — $800,000 · 9125 Angie Way, Grand Ledge, Michigan

A 2002 house on Angie Way anchors the week’s list at $800,000. Set on a 1.389-acre lot in the Crane Meadow neighborhood of Grand Ledge, the home has four bedrooms, three full bathrooms and a half bath across a reported 4,340 square feet. It went under contract 29 days after the current listing date and closed on August 13, 2026.

The kitchen has been updated with quartz countertops and hardwood flooring, and a three-season sunroom looks out on the surrounding grounds. A finished walkout basement holds a wet bar. Outside, a heated in-ground pool with an automatic cover sits near a 24-by-40-foot insulated outbuilding, and the attached three-car garage measures 770 square feet.

The house sits in a quiet, private neighborhood and carries exclusive deeded access to approximately 45 acres of recreational land, with a stocked pond, trails, fishing and hunting. The property previously changed hands for $330,000 in 2003.

Brock Fletcher of Keller Williams Realty Lansing was the listing agent. The $800,000 closing put Fletcher on the listing side of the highest-priced sale in RealtyWire’s Lansing Metro Area Top 5 for the week. Adriane Lau of RE/MAX Real Estate Professionals represented the buyer.

RealtyWire selected these transactions from publicly reported residential sales identified for the calendar week ending Sunday, August 16, 2026. The report may exclude private, off-market, delayed or nondisclosed transactions. Prices, property details and professional representation are reported as available at publication and may be updated following confirmation from transaction participants.
